工具

1.PHP环境: 最好是PHP7, 安装了mysqli扩展

2.nginx/Apache: 可以在浏览器端访问到这个脚本

功能

1.导出html, 可以选择是否带左侧目录

2.导出html形式的Word, 提示下载

3.支持导出全部表和部分表

4.导出部分表时支持正则表达式

用法示例

include('./DBdic.php');//浏览器显示DBdic::ini('localhost', 'db_name', 'username', 'password')->outForBrowser();//浏览器显示, 带左侧菜单DBdic::ini('localhost', 'db_name', 'username', 'password')->outForBrowserWithMenu();//下载word文档DBdic::ini('localhost', 'db_name', 'username', 'password')->outForWord();//只导出一个表DBdic::ini('localhost', 'db_name', 'username', 'password')->setExportTable('user')->outForBrowser();//导出部分表, 支持正则DBdic::ini('localhost', 'db_name', 'username', 'password')->setExportTableArray(['user', 'goods_.*', 'product_\d{4}'])->outForBrowser();

源码下载

码云 Summer-Mysql-Dic(https://gitee.com/myDcool/PHP-DBDIC)

更多php相关知识,请访问php教程!

更多相关文章

  1. php中的如何使用正则替换
  2. 常用的php正则表达及语法注解总结
  3. PHP中正则表达式详解(代码实例)
  4. PHP正则表达式之2种模式和Cookie详解(代码实例)
  5. 如何解决在php用gd库输出图片到微信浏览器出现乱码
  6. PHP以正则表达式验证手机号码
  7. PHP实现手机网站支付(兼容微信浏览器)
  8. 关于PHP正则匹配中文
  9. 分享一个匹配8-16位数字和字母密码的正则表达式

随机推荐

  1. 1 第一个网络爬虫(1)
  2. (004)CSS选择符(selector)
  3. HTML显示日期时间代码 - [js 特效代码]
  4. 这个html太奇怪了,源码看不到"下一页"字符
  5. 基于html属性为gulp构建过程添加条件
  6. 为什么v-align中的将文本放在图像下面
  7. 您试图显示配置为只允许执行和脚本权限的
  8. 为什么IE7没有正确地将 块复制到剪贴板?
  9. ThinkPHP生成静态页buildHtml方法
  10. HTML哪些是块级元素,哪些是行内元素、